Output 9871fd89ff6d592bac5145f267f12ed08a3d618fff0bf4314ea1d62bfdb960ca:0

value
111022
script pubkey
OP_HASH160 OP_PUSHBYTES_20 868195ee202b94f5092a8e9d173cf12cd046a18b OP_EQUAL
address
3DxDi23iHnkuursZVpURww9PbvjvWr6PjH
transaction
9871fd89ff6d592bac5145f267f12ed08a3d618fff0bf4314ea1d62bfdb960ca
confirmations
157260
spent
true